Russia’s Use of North Korean Weapons in Ukraine Raises Alarms in the US and Ukraine

At the start of the year, there were reports from both the US and Ukraine which confirmed that Russia had used North Korean weapons and ammunition in the war in Ukraine.

– This is a significant and worrying escalation of North Korea’s support for Russia, said John Kirby in the US National Security Council when the news became known.

Furthermore, Kirby claimed that Russia primarily wanted to use Iranian missiles. Ukraine’s spy chief Kyrylo Budanov agrees in an interview with Financial Times.

“Too good” to ask North Korea for help

In the interview, which is reproduced by Business InsiderBudanov says that Russia has always seen itself as “too good” to ask North Korea for help.

According to Budanov, North Korea is now Russia’s largest supplier of weapons, and the same man is convinced that North Korea has been Russia’s salvation.

– They have transferred a significant amount of artillery ammunition. This has given Russia some breathing room. Without their help, the situation would have been catastrophic, says Budanov.

Forging closer ties with Iran

After Russia launched its full-scale invasion of neighboring Ukraine, the West has turned its back on Russia.

Several crippling sanctions have led to Russia suffocating Russia’s own arms industry, and they have had to ask countries such as Iran – and now also North Korea for help.

Earlier this month, the Wall Street Journal could also reveal that Russia will buy short-range ballistic missiles from Iran.

This will significantly improve the Russians’ ability to attack Ukraine, the newspaper wrote, citing several high-ranking US officials.

Last year, the White House also said it saw more indications that Russia and Iran are forming an increasingly close defense alliance.
